Mountain West Conference (MW) Members Tuition Comparison
The 2024 average tuition & fees of MW member schools is $8,736 for state residents and $24,565 for out-of-state students. For graduate programs, the average tuition & fees is $8,830 for state residents and $22,849 for out-of-state students.
The average living costs at MW colleges is $18,664 when a student lives in on-campus facilities such as dormitory and school owned apartments. The off-campus living cost is $18,516 for academic year 2023-2024.
The following list shows the colleges with highest and/or lowest tuition and other college cost among the MW schools.
- Colorado State University-Fort Collins has the most expensive undergraduate tuition & fees of $33,751 and California State University-Fresno has the cheapest undergraduate costs of $18,860.
- Colorado State University-Fort Collins has the most expensive graduate tuition & fees of $29,786 and California State University-Fresno has the cheapest graduate costs of $17,918.
- San Diego State University has the most expensive on-campus living costs of $24,874 and Utah State University has the lowest costs of $12,836.
- San Jose State University has the highest off-campus living costs of $24,341 and Utah State University has the lowest costs of $13,082.
- Colorado State University-Fort Collins has the most expensive undergraduate tuition per credit hour of $1,550 and San Diego State University has the lowest costs of $398.
- Colorado State University-Fort Collins has the highest graduate tuition per credit hour of $1,505 and San Diego State University has the cheapest costs of $398.

MW Schools Tuition Comparison
The following Table compares MW schools with tuition, fees, and living costs based on 2024 tuition data. The amount in parentheses is the in-state tuition rate if the school in the row is public. The tuition per credit hour is for the part-time students and overloaded credits of full-time students. The "-" value in column(s) means that the data has not been reported or available.

College Name | Undergraduate Tuition & Fees | Graduate Tuition & Fees | On-Campus Living Costs | Off-Campus Living Costs | Undergraduate Tuition per Credit Hour | Graduate Tuition per Credit Hour |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
California State University-Fresno Fresno, CA Public, 4 years four-years | $18,860 ($6,980) | $17,918 ($8,414) | 15,832 | 21,489 | $403 | $403 |
San Diego State University San Diego, CA Public, 4 years four-years | $20,170 ($8,290) | $19,228 ($9,724) | 24,874 | 22,250 | $398 | $398 |
San Jose State University San Jose, CA Public, 4 years four-years | $19,872 ($7,992) | $18,930 ($9,426) | 23,380 | 24,341 | $398 | $398 |
Colorado State University-Fort Collins Fort Collins, CO Public, 4 years four-years | $33,751 ($12,896) | $29,786 ($13,584) | 18,343 | 17,416 | $1,550 | $1,505 |
United States Air Force Academy USAF Academy, CO Public, 4 years four-years | - | - | - | - | - | - |
Boise State University Boise, ID Public, 4 years four-years | $26,976 ($8,782) | $28,605 ($10,486) | 22,333 | 19,144 | $819 | $930 |
University of Nevada-Las Vegas Las Vegas, NV Public, 4 years four-years | $26,098 ($9,142) | $23,933 ($6,977) | 16,122 | 18,158 | $551 | $678 |
University of Nevada-Reno Reno, NV Public, 4 years four-years | $25,950 ($8,994) | $23,540 ($6,584) | 19,070 | 19,070 | $566 | $685 |
University of New Mexico-Main Campus Albuquerque, NM Public, 4 years four-years | $26,450 ($8,115) | $21,550 ($7,395) | 16,592 | 16,592 | $1,048 | $1,138 |
Utah State University Logan, UT Public, 4 years four-years | $24,802 ($9,228) | $24,008 ($7,595) | 12,836 | 13,082 | $886 | $1,109 |
University of Wyoming Laramie, WY Public, 4 years four-years | $22,718 ($6,938) | $20,996 ($8,116) | 17,260 | 13,620 | $851 | $1,062 |
Average | $24,565 | $22,849 | 18,664 | 18,516 | $747 | $831 |
